2,2-Dimethyl-1-(phenylmethyl)piperazine

Description:
2,2-Dimethyl-1-(phenylmethyl)piperazine is an organic compound characterized by its piperazine core, which is a six-membered ring containing two nitrogen atoms. This compound features two methyl groups attached to the second carbon of the piperazine ring, contributing to its steric bulk and potentially influencing its biological activity. The presence of a phenylmethyl group at the first position enhances its lipophilicity, which may affect its solubility and interaction with biological membranes. Typically, compounds like this may exhibit properties such as moderate to high polarity, depending on the balance of hydrophobic and hydrophilic groups. The compound may also participate in hydrogen bonding due to the nitrogen atoms, which can influence its reactivity and interactions with other molecules. Its structural features suggest potential applications in medicinal chemistry, particularly in the development of pharmaceuticals targeting various biological pathways. However, specific biological activities and safety profiles would require further investigation through empirical studies.
Formula:C13H20N2
InChI:InChI=1S/C13H20N2/c1-13(2)11-14-8-9-15(13)10-12-6-4-3-5-7-12/h3-7,14H,8-11H2,1-2H3
InChI key:InChIKey=ZDYGXJLQTUNTKJ-UHFFFAOYSA-N
SMILES:C(N1C(C)(C)CNCC1)C2=CC=CC=C2
Synonyms:
  • 2,2-Dimethyl-1-(phenylmethyl)piperazine
  • 1-Benzyl-2,2-dimethylpiperazine
  • Piperazine, 2,2-dimethyl-1-(phenylmethyl)-
